Durham Police investigators are looking for victims or patients who may have health concerns to come forward after an unlicensed/unregistered clinic was located in Oshawa.
On Wednesday, October 6, 2021 members of the DRPS – Financial Crimes Unit completed an investigation in relation to a suspected unlicensed and unregistered cosmetic surgery clinic being operated in a private residence. The primary suspected procedures were Botox, non-surgical nose augmentations, fillers and hair transplant surgeries.
Investigators executed a search warrant at a residence on Pilgrim Square in Oshawa, working in conjunction with The College of Physicians and Surgeons of Ontario, Durham Region Health Department, and Durham EMS. The suspect was arrested in the residence without incident.
Police seized numerous documents and evidence at the scene.
Isaac Aceveda, age 51, of Pilgrim Square in Oshawa is charged with: False Pretense Over $5000. He was released on an Undertaking.
